Laundry Room Water Removal v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small water spill (less than 100 sq. Ft.) | Yes | No | DIY with a wet vacuum and towels |
| Large water spill (over 100 sq. Ft.) | No | Yes | Professional equipment and expertise required |
| Standing water with musty odors | No | Yes | Professional equipment and expertise required to remove excess moisture and prevent mold growth |
| Water damage with warped or buckled flooring | No | Yes | Professional equipment and expertise required to repair or replace damaged flooring |
| Water damage with electrical issues | No | Yes | Professional equipment and expertise required to safely repair or replace electrical parts |

Laundry Room Water Removal Cost in Sacate Village, AZ
The cost of Laundry Room Water Removal services can vary depending on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ions in Sacate Village, AZ. Our prices are competitive and we work with your insurance company to ensure a smooth claims process.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ction and drying |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area and severity of damage |
| Removal of damaged materials | $200 – $1,000 | Quantity and type of materials damaged |
| Dehumidification and ventilation |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area and type of equipment used |
| Emergency services (after hours or weekends) | More 10-20% of total cost | Emergency services need more personnel and equipment |
| Insurance claims processing | Free | We work with your insurance company to ensure a smooth claims process |
Exact pricing depends on an on-site assessment, and free estimates are available to ensure you know what to expect.

Common Questions About Laundry Room Water Removal
What causes water damage in laundry rooms?
Water damage in laundry rooms can be caused by a variety of factors, including clogged drains, faulty washing machines, and burst pipes. Regular maintenance and inspections can help prevent water damage.
How long does it take to dry a laundry room?
The time it takes to dry a laundry room depends on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area. Our team uses industrial-strength fans and dehumidifiers to dry the area quickly and efficiently.
